编程中sql是什么

fiy 其他 26

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SQL(Structured Query Language)是一种用于管理关系型数据库的编程语言。它用于定义数据库结构、查询和管理数据。SQL具有以下重要特点:

    1. 数据库结构定义:SQL可以用于创建和修改数据库表、视图和索引。通过SQL,开发人员可以定义表的结构、字段的类型以及数据之间的关系。

    2. 数据查询:SQL支持丰富的查询操作,包括选择、过滤、排序和聚合等操作。通过SQL语句,开发人员可以从数据库中检索所需的数据。

    3. 数据操作:SQL可以用于插入、更新和删除数据。开发人员可以使用SQL语句修改数据库中的数据,以便满足特定的业务需求。

    4. 数据库事务处理:SQL支持事务处理,可以确保数据的一致性和完整性。开发人员可以使用SQL语句开启、提交或回滚事务,以保证操作的原子性。

    5. 数据安全性:SQL提供了对数据库的安全性管理。开发人员可以使用SQL语句进行用户验证、权限控制以及数据加密等操作,保护数据库中的敏感信息。

    总之,SQL是一种广泛应用于关系型数据库的编程语言,它提供了丰富的功能和灵活的操作方式,帮助开发人员有效地管理和操作数据。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L(Structured Query Language,结构化查询语言)是用于管理关系型数据库系统的编程语言。它用于在关系型数据库中存储、检索、操作和管理数据。

    1. SQL是一种标准化的语言:SQL是由美国国立标准与技术研究所(NIST)于1986年发布的国际标准,在关系型数据库管理系统(RDBMS)中广泛使用。不同的数据库管理系统(如Oracle、MySQL、SQL Server等)都遵循SQL标准,但可能存在细微的差异。

    2. SQL用于数据库的操作:通过SQL,可以对数据库进行多种操作,包括创建表格(通过CREATE TABLE),插入数据(通过INSERT INTO)检索数据(通过SELECT),更新数据(通过UPDATE)和删除数据(通过DELETE)等。SQL提供了一种简单且高效的方式来管理和操作数据库。

    3. SQL支持查询语句:SQL的一个主要功能是支持查询语句。使用SELECT语句可以从数据库中检索数据,并根据特定条件进行过滤、排序和聚合操作。SELECT语句可以包含多个表格的连接和复杂的条件和逻辑运算符,使得用户能够从庞大的数据集中获取需要的信息。

    4. SQL支持数据定义语言(DDL)和数据操作语言(DML):SQL被分为两个主要的类别,即DDL和DML。DDL是用于定义数据库结构的语言,用于创建、修改和删除数据库、表格、索引等对象。DML用于操作数据库中的数据,包括插入、更新和删除数据。

    5. SQL具有高度的灵活性和可扩展性:SQL是一种强大的语言,具有丰富的功能和语法。它可以使用复杂的查询和操作来处理大量的数据,同时可以轻松扩展以满足不断变化的需求。SQL也支持存储过程、触发器和视图等高级功能,使得用户可以更加灵活地管理和操作数据库。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L (Structured Query Language),中文又称为结构化查询语言,是一种用于管理关系数据库系统的标准化语言。它是一种专门用来与数据库进行交互的编程语言,用于创建、插入、更新和删除数据库中的数据,以及查询数据库中的数据。

    SQL被广泛应用于各种关系数据库管理系统(RDBMS),如MySQL、Oracle、SQL Server等。通过使用SQL,开发人员可以轻松地与数据库进行通信和操纵。

    SQL的功能和用途非常广泛,可以用于以下几方面:

    1. 数据定义(DDL):用于创建、修改和删除数据库中的表、索引、视图等数据库对象。常见的DDL命令包括CREATE、ALTER和DROP。

    2. 数据操纵(DML):用于向数据库中插入、更新和删除数据。常见的DML命令包括INSERT、UPDATE和DELETE。

    3. 数据查询(DQL): 用于从数据库中查询数据。常见的DQL命令是SELECT,它允许我们使用多种条件过滤、排序和聚合数据。

    4. 数据控制(DCL):用于控制数据库的安全访问。常见的DCL命令包括GRANT和REVOKE,允许或拒绝用户对数据库对象的访问权限。

    下面是SQL的一些常用操作流程和方法:

    1. 连接到数据库:使用数据库管理系统提供的连接函数,如MySQL的mysqli_connect()或PDO的new PDO(),连接到数据库服务器。

    2. 创建表:使用CREATE TABLE语句创建表。在语句中指定表名和列名,并定义每列的数据类型和约束。

    3. 插入数据:使用INSERT语句将数据插入到表中。在语句中指定要插入的列和对应的值。

    4. 更新数据:使用UPDATE语句更新表中的数据。在语句中指定要更新的列和新的值,并使用WHERE子句指定更新的条件。

    5. 删除数据:使用DELETE语句删除表中的数据。在语句中使用WHERE子句指定要删除的行的条件。

    6. 查询数据:使用SELECT语句查询表中的数据。在语句中指定要查询的列和条件,并可以使用ORDER BY对结果进行排序。

    7. 创建索引:使用CREATE INDEX语句在表上创建索引。索引可以提高查询性能。

    8. 创建视图:使用CREATE VIEW语句创建视图。视图是一个虚拟表,基于其他表或视图的查询结果。

    9. 管理数据库对象:使用ALTER和DROP语句修改或删除数据库对象,如表、索引和视图。

    10. 数据权限管理:使用GRANT和REVOKE语句授予或收回用户对数据库对象的访问权限。

    总结来说,SQL是一种用于管理关系数据库的编程语言,用于创建、插入、更新和删除数据,以及查询数据。通过使用SQL,开发人员可以有效地与数据库进行交互,实现对数据的操作和管理。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部